Transaction dc2fb283f8e8368b08868eed432d7458c7d4508dee30f6f94ca7150237fc059d
1 Input
2 Outputs
- dc2fb283f8e8368b08868eed432d7458c7d4508dee30f6f94ca7150237fc059d:0
- dc2fb283f8e8368b08868eed432d7458c7d4508dee30f6f94ca7150237fc059d:1
value 2884394
address 1LAbkDjpjusEXit7CUhPmWoz44LDZqFmgR
value 31735691
address 13a76S2TFTpHTVhZT5UHAK7VMzwohUggEe